Role Overview:

Role Overview:

As a product marketing manager, you will be a growth architect working across functions and departments to drive demand for Trellix Network Detection and Response (NDR). You will create resonant messaging that connects customer problems and use cases to product capabilities. You will develop marketing programs and create content that drive each phase of the buyer journey: from awareness to decision, and through to customer retention. You will act as a conductor, orchestrating product management, sales, marketing, partners, and industry influencers to tell a consistent, resonant story that drives awareness and demand - and ultimately customer success.

About the role:

  • Buyer expert / advocate - Be an expert on your buyers' problems and key value drivers. Understand their decision-making process, including how they evaluate critical capabilities and competitive alternatives.

  • Messaging and thought leadership - Craft messaging source documents that serve as the single source of truth for all internal and outbound messaging. Craft resonant stories to help underscore our thought leader position in the market; contribute regularly via internal sales enablement, our corporate blog, customer-facing webinars, and social media outlets.

  • Demand generation - Collaborate with our global demand team and regional field marketing to content aligned to the buyers' journey and develop programs to drive awareness and demand.

  • Sales enablement - Evangelize your product story to direct and partner sales teams. Develop sales tools needed to support and accelerate the selling process. Work with sales engineering to develop demos that bring our story to life.

  • Evangelist - Craft and deliver compelling presentations for both internal and external, online and in-person events that drive awareness, understanding and demand for email as well as a new, paradigm-shifting service offering. Drive analyst relations content to support building deeper relationships with key industry influencers through briefings, inquiries, and strategy sessions.
